diff options
author | alfred <alfred@FreeBSD.org> | 2002-06-29 17:56:34 +0000 |
---|---|---|
committer | alfred <alfred@FreeBSD.org> | 2002-06-29 17:56:34 +0000 |
commit | ce846a9c494e4339e4517f19e44c5d6693c8a636 (patch) | |
tree | bcde1b94046579df4540239b2a2ef028ece64c3d /sys/kern/vfs_export.c | |
parent | ade07015045dbf6893eed9041dfd911d13ace34a (diff) | |
download | FreeBSD-src-ce846a9c494e4339e4517f19e44c5d6693c8a636.zip FreeBSD-src-ce846a9c494e4339e4517f19e44c5d6693c8a636.tar.gz |
Unbreak computation of 'smask' that I broke when removing caddr_t.
Submitted by: bde
Diffstat (limited to 'sys/kern/vfs_export.c')
-rw-r--r-- | sys/kern/vfs_export.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/sys/kern/vfs_export.c b/sys/kern/vfs_export.c index ec135bd..4df081a 100644 --- a/sys/kern/vfs_export.c +++ b/sys/kern/vfs_export.c @@ -129,7 +129,7 @@ vfs_hang_addrlist(mp, nep, argp) if (saddr->sa_len > argp->ex_addrlen) saddr->sa_len = argp->ex_addrlen; if (argp->ex_masklen) { - smask = (struct sockaddr *) (saddr + argp->ex_addrlen); + smask = (struct sockaddr *)((caddr_t)saddr + argp->ex_addrlen); error = copyin(argp->ex_mask, smask, argp->ex_masklen); if (error) goto out; |